## ScanBridge: scanner reads not reaching inventory

Don't panic — this one's common. First check that the ScanBridge relay service is running on the warehouse gateway box; it silently dies if the USB hub gets power-cycled. Restart it, then fire a test scan from the Pelora handheld. If reads still don't land in StockTrack within 10 seconds, escalate. Step-by-step diagnostics are documented on the internal page.

dashboard of yafog-fajof = https://jira.tolvaqsys.internal/pages/pages/projects/49fe21c4

Meeting notes — Thursday stand-up, Fernleigh Depot kit. Quick one: the new uniforms for the Fernleigh depot crew arrived a week early, so we're not waiting for the official launch to ship them. Twelve boxes, sorted by size, all labelled. Dispatch will send them out on Monday's first run rather than splitting across two days. Marta flagged that the hi-vis jackets are in a separate carton — keep it with the rest. The hand-over instruction for the driver is below.

dispatch memo: the lamwyn fenwyn courier leaves the wenir ledger at gate 7175 under passcode 822969

## Deploying the Gatewick Proctor Queue

Deploys are pretty painless: push to main, wait for the pipeline, then watch the queue drain dashboard for five minutes. If candidates pile up mid-exam, roll back first and ask questions later — the queue replays safely. Everything the workers care about lives in one config block, shown here for reference.

settings of bafof-yagef:
JOROX_PIN=8740
JOROX_TENANT=pelox
JOROX_METRICS_HOST=metrics.jorox.qorvelworks.internal
JOROX_SEAL=seal_c78f63c1
JOROX_STANDBY_TEAM=norax